摘要
Multi criteria decision analysis (MCDA) covers both data and experience. It is very common to solve the problems with many parameters and uncertainties. Geographic information systems (GIS) supported solutions improve and speed up the decision process. Analytical Hierarchy Process (AHP) as a MCDA method is employed for solving the geotechnical problems. In this study, geotechnical parameters namely soil type, SPT (N) blow number, shear wave velocity (Vs) and depth of underground water level (DUWL) have been engaged in MCDA and GIS. In terms of geotechnical aspects, the settlement suitability of the municipal area was analyzed by the method. MCDA results were compatible with the geotechnical observations and experience. The method can be employed in geotechnical oriented microzoning studies if the criteria are well evaluated.
